    iPad   Looks like there's a new "i" gadget ready to hit the markets this spring...the new iPad. Yes, it's all nice & shiny...but is it really (I mean REALLY) worth it? Without flash, for example, Farmville & other similar online flash applications aren't accessible. Without a camera, chat is virtually limited to texted messages, a step backward. Without USB ports or infrared capability, uploading digital camera pictures basically translates to downloading photos into the iPad after uploading them from my digital camera to my PC...meaningless. Without true support for HD video, one might as well pop a DVD or Blu-Ray disc into their PC or disc player for quality videos.
